Notebook function
During a phone call you can enter a phone number in the phone's temporary
memory to be dialled later.
NT/NTBA (NT2 a/b)
Network terminating device (NT = Network Terminator and NTBA = Network
Terminator Basic Access). The public ISDN network is terminated with the NT. The NT
acts as a bridge to the existing telephone outlet. Only the NT can or may be
connected to the ISDN telephone outlet. Under no circumstances should analogue
terminals also be connected to the phone outlet. ISDN terminals and additional ISDN
outlets are connected to the NT.
Analogue telephones must only be connected to analogue ports (a/b-Port) of the NT
2 a/b.

Open listening
At the touch of a key, all those present in a room can listen in to a phone call via an
integrated loudspeaker. See also "Handsfree talking".
Outgoing MSN, freely selectable
A performance feature which helps you to individually determine which MSN should
be used for the following call. This is not only important for the phone number
display on the called handset but also for billing charges. This is because call
charges, which can be broken down free of charge according to MSN on the network
provider invoice, are billed according to the MSN used to make the call.
P
Parking
A call is parked when you want to unplug the telephone during a call, or you want
to continue your call from another telephone with the same connection. The
connection is retained while it is parked.

Phonebook
An added feature on a phone allowing the name and phone number of several users
to be stored. The phone numbers can quickly be found and dialled.
PIN
Abbreviation for Personal Identification Number. Protects against unauthorised use,
e.g., system PIN, AM PIN, handset PIN.
